Role Overview

We are seeking an experienced and proactive Project Manager to oversee the delivery of domestic retrofit projects, including insulation, renewable technologies and heating systems.

This is a hands‑on role that combines project management with site‑based activity. The Project Manager will be responsible for overseeing retrofit projects from pre‑start through to completion, ensuring quality, compliance, and customer satisfaction are consistently achieved. They will manage installation teams and subcontractors, working closely with the wider support function to ensure successful project delivery.

The role reports to the Operations Director and will be assisted by the Business Support team for administrative and coordination tasks.

Demonstrable experience delivering Energy Efficiency retrofit projects in Social Housing and Area Based Schemes compliant with PAS 2030 / 2035 and MCS is essential.
